What is the name of Osaka's airport?
The majority of travelers prefer to fly into Kansai Intl. Airport (KIX) when visiting the buzzing city of Osaka.
How far is KIX from central Osaka?
KIX is 40 kilometers from downtown Osaka, so be prepared for a reasonable commute into the city.
What airport is best to fly into Osaka?
With plenty of airports to take your pick of, Osaka is one of those places that's easy to book a flight to on short notice. The terminals that see most of the city's air travel are Kansai Intl. Airport (40 kilometers from downtown), ITM (11 kilometers from downtown) and UKB (26 kilometers from downtown).

How long is the flight to Osaka Airport?
If it's Tokyo you're departing, you'll be in the air for around 1 hour and 25 minutes before you arrive in Osaka. Runway to runway from Seoul takes approximately 1 hour and 46 minutes and from Sapporo, 2 hours and 10 minutes.

Depending on where you're coming from, your flight to Osaka could be simple and straightforward or it could go on forever. We've pulled together some handy hints that will help you start your unforgettable escape on the right foot. What to pack in your hand luggage:

  • The secret to having a stress-free flight experience is to pack ahead. So, let's start with the basics: passport, boarding pass, cash and any vital medications. Next, bring on board items that'll help keep you entertained, like some electronic devices or a few magazines. It's also a wise idea to pack your chargers, a quality neck pillow and a pair of earplugs. Last but not least, be sure to pop in toiletries like a toothbrush, cleansing wipes and a fresh change of clothes.

Do not pack the following items in your hand luggage:

  • Leave all your full-sized bottles of shampoo and hair gel in your checked luggage. Any gels or liquids in your carry-on bag larger than 3.4 ounces (100 milliliters) will be confiscated by authorities. Pointed or sharp objects, like your precious pocket knife, and products which are explosive or flammable, such as aerosols and fireworks, are also not allowed.

What to wear on a flight:

  • Your main aim is to feel as comfortable as possible. Go for a pair of slip-on shoes, dress in loose, natural-fiber clothing and remember to bring a sweater in case you get chilly in the cabin.
  • Deep vein thrombosis (DVT) can pose a risk on long-distance flights. It's the result of blood clotting due to poor circulation and inactivity, so do some gentle leg and foot exercises in your seat and consider wearing compression socks or tights.

How to get through airport security fast when flying to Osaka?
It's easy — be prepared. We've compiled some top tips for a speedy trip through security. Look out Osaka, here you come:

  • Be sure to keep your travel documents and ID close by. They're the first things you'll be asked to present to airport security.
  • Next up, both you and your carry-on bag will be X-rayed. To speed things up, take off anything that might set the alarms off. Personal belongings such as your belt, jacket and earphones need to go through the machine.
  • For just a few minutes, you'll have to unplug from technology. Your phone, tablet and any other electronic devices will also need to be sent through the scanner.
  • Don't forget to remove gels and liquids from your carry-on bag. They often need to be sent through the X-ray machine separately. Each product should be no larger than 3.4 ounces (100 milliliters) and everything must fit in a single quart-size (one liter), clear zip-lock bag.
  • There's a chance you'll need to take your shoes off for scanning, so wearing slip-on shoes is always a good idea.
  • Pocket knives and other sharp items are prohibited in the cabin. They'll be seized at security, so pack them safely away in your checked bags.
